    Basically, what I've noticed in my own self-development throughout life is that you need to take in information and focus on one specific thing until it becomes second nature and can do it without thinking about it. This does involve putting yourself out there and sometimes making a fool of yourself, but eventually you'll get it down. For instance let's say you want to learn how to smile in a more inviting way. You might first start with looking at images of attractive people and see how they smile and then try and replicate their smile and different variations. Then you go out and try these variations on people on the street until you notice one variation gives positive feedback from most people you come across. Finally you practice that smile until you can do it without thinking about it. Now you can move on to the next thing, be it communication, fashion, fitness, and so forth. It's very difficult to teach, but there's a magical place where you take in the right amount of information and then put that information in to practice. Just like anything you have to practice, alter the plan, and tinker until you find the sweet spot
